Output b299ae0fb3d2b7ab36121a4315729d886011fe86f3edb7949ee0e92e754c3839:6

value
34950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c84069ecec998faa453b36ce437408050ac707a OP_EQUAL
address
3EVzgiaNfq8bF7151mTKnuVH8AYFfNcnnH
transaction
b299ae0fb3d2b7ab36121a4315729d886011fe86f3edb7949ee0e92e754c3839
spent
true